About this position

The Philadelphia Municipal Court is a court of limited jurisdiction and responsible for trying criminal offenses carrying maximum sentences of incarceration of five years or less, civil cases in which the amount is $10,000 or less for Small Claims; landlord-tenant cases; and $15,000 in real-estate and school-tax cases. The Municipal Court has initial jurisdiction in processing every adult criminal arrest in Philadelphia, and conducts preliminary hearings for most adult felony cases.

Eligibility requirements

  • Must be at least 18 years old
  • Must be a resident of the district
  • Must have relevant professional experience
  • Candidate must be a resident of the state for at least one year; a member of the state bar; and under the age of 75.
